第十六篇 机器视觉案例 之 凹点检测 文章目录 第十六篇 机器视觉案例 之 凹点检测 1.案例要求 2.实现思路 2.1 方式一:斑点工具加画线工具加点线距离工具 2.2 方法二 使用斑点工具的结果集边缘坐标的横坐标最大值ImageBoundMaxX 2.3 方法三 使用斑点工具的结果集凹点结果集 ConvexHull() 3.使用控件 3.1 斑点工具 —— CogBlobTool 3.2 画线工具 —— CogCreateLineTool 3.3 点到线距离工具 —— CogDistancePointLineTool 4.代码逻辑 5.实现效果 6.知识点总结 6.1 坐标排序 1.案例要求 检测两个凹点的坐标 2.实现思路 2.1 方式一:斑点工具加画线工具加点线距离工具 设置斑点工具的区域 在靠近凹点的一侧画一条垂直的直线 循环遍历斑点图像的每一个点到到直线的距离,距离最短的两个区域即为凹点区域,对应的点就是凹点